Output 04998406a82424140f903fdccf3cfdfd62fbbc8131145a2f19beda90c177c364:0

value
521194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d432893496a0fc8c809d26588e07349db7aebf OP_EQUAL
address
3R1iSCFRqnXxMibrBrPKD6LH83Xjj3jMns
transaction
04998406a82424140f903fdccf3cfdfd62fbbc8131145a2f19beda90c177c364
confirmations
348397
spent
true